Lyric Darling One
Written by Susanna Hoffs, Mark Linkous, David Lowery & Davey Faragher
Produced by David Baerwald, David Kitay & Susanna Hoffs
Released on Susanna Hoffs (1996)
I hear a voice that fights the wind
The rain that keeps fallin
And I feel a river rushin in
Between you and me.
You keep lookin
For somethin that s not lost
I wish that somehow
I could get you across.
Oh, won t you rest your worries
Darling one
Sweetheart
Oh, won t you rest your worries
Darling one
Sweetheart
Sweetheart.
When they told you the big parade
Had long since passed
I saw you waiting there
For the music to come back.
Feelin blue
Cause there s so much to live up to
I wish that somehow
I could give it to you.
Oh, won t you rest your worries
Darling one
Sweetheart
Oh, won t you rest your worries
Darling one
Sweetheart
Sweetheart.
Oh-oh, woe.
Won t you rest your worries
Darlin one
Sweetheart
Oh, won t you rest your worries
Darling one
Sweetheart
Sweetheart.
